Motivation
Tonic does not currently handle the case when Prost is configured to compile well-known protobuf types instead of just referencing
prost_types. See #521 for a full description of the problem.Solution
Allow the user to configure Tonic to compile well-known protobuf types. That configuration is passed through to Prost.
